Toilet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ill with minimal damage | Yes | No | You can handle it yourself with a wet vacuum and some towels. |
| Large water spill with significant damage | No | Yes | You’ll need specialized equipment and expertise to extract the water and dry the area. |
| Water damage with mold growth | No | Yes | Mold growth needs professional equipment and expertise to remove safely and effectively. |
| Water damage with structural damage | No | Yes | Structural damage needs professional expertise to repair and restore your property. |
| Water damage with electrical or gas leaks | No | Yes | Electrical or gas leaks need professional expertise to safely repair and restore your property. |
| Water damage with significant health risks | No | Yes | Significant health risks need professional expertise to safely remove and restore your property. |

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ost In South Euclid, OH
The cost of Toilet Overflow Water Removal var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are estimates, not guarantees. Get a free estimate today.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water and the complexity of the job |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ed |
| Restoration and rep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air |
| Mold remediation | $1,500 – $6,000 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the job |
| Structural repair | $3,000 – $15,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air |
| Electrical or gas rep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| The complexity of the job and the materials needed for repair |
